Title: NUTRITIONAL STATUS OF MACEDONIAN HIGH SCHOOL STUDENTS AND RELATION TO LEVEL OF EDUCATION AND EMPLOYMENTS STATUS OF THEIR PARENTS

Abstract: The aim of this study was to evaluate the nutritional status in Macedonian high school students and relation with the level of education and employments status of their parents. In this study 1207 adolescent students (616 males and 591 females) at age of 11 to 14 years were included. We measured weight and height using standard procedures while body mass index was calculated and these values were used to assess nutritional status. The examinees fill the questionnaire with the data for parent’s education and employment. We found significant difference between male students who were with risk of obesity and overweight, with high persentage of students with employed mother, contrary to those students with unemployed mother. According to the level of education in father, there was significant difference in the group of underweight females with the higher percentage being underweight with father with lower education, primary school, and only 1,4% were underweight with father with university education. Our data suggest that parental level of education and employment status are in relation with the nutritional status of Macedonian adolescents.
